Output 907a7664bcacb3c5551fbcc9c20c6139ad4f48ede83b690fb5835a8f57fad47c:0

value
1975816966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fb2d5975570bab9db4efbc26b49ae6b9ace54dd OP_EQUAL
address
3LdE2t27m3dG1TLKSSbgA84bydmdwUkjwk
transaction
907a7664bcacb3c5551fbcc9c20c6139ad4f48ede83b690fb5835a8f57fad47c
spent
true